The most important component of the oral contraceptive pills is:
Correct answer: C. Progesterone
- A. Thyroxine
- B. Luteinizing hormone
- C. Progesterone
- D. Growth hormone
Explanation
The most common type of pill is the so called "combined pill". It contains a combination of synthetic progestins (acting like progesterone) and estrogen. Combined pills inhibit ovulation by inhibiting the normal release of FSH and LH from the pituitary. They mimic the hormones produced by the corpus luteum, causing the uterine walls to thicken, as during normal menstrual cycle, and suppressing the release of FSH and LH.

About Reproduction
Human reproduction covers the male and female reproductive organs, gamete formation, fertilization, implantation and hormonal regulation. The menstrual cycle includes ovarian and uterine changes controlled by pituitary and ovarian hormones, while sexually transmitted diseases are studied through their causes, transmission, symptoms, prevention and effects on fertility.
